在Angular 4/CLI的TypeScript中调试是指在开发过程中使用调试工具来定位和解决代码中的问题。调试是开发过程中非常重要的一环,它可以帮助开发人员快速定位和修复代码中的错误,提高开发效率和代码质量。
在Angular 4/CLI的TypeScript中调试可以通过以下步骤进行:
- 使用Chrome浏览器进行调试:Angular 4/CLI使用Chrome浏览器作为默认的开发调试工具。在Chrome浏览器中,可以通过打开开发者工具来进行调试。按下F12键或右键点击页面并选择“检查”选项来打开开发者工具。在“Sources”选项卡中可以查看和编辑TypeScript代码,并在代码中设置断点进行调试。
- 设置断点:在需要调试的代码行上点击左侧的行号,即可设置断点。断点是指在代码执行到该行时,程序会暂停执行,开发人员可以查看变量的值、调用栈等信息。通过断点可以逐步执行代码,定位问题所在。
- 调试工具的使用:在开发者工具中,可以使用调试工具栏上的按钮来控制代码的执行。例如,可以使用“继续”按钮继续执行代码,使用“单步执行”按钮逐行执行代码,使用“逐过程执行”按钮逐步执行函数等。
- 查看变量和调用栈:在断点暂停执行时,可以查看当前的变量值和调用栈信息。在开发者工具的右侧面板中,可以查看当前作用域中的变量和它们的值。在调用栈面板中,可以查看当前执行的函数调用链,帮助开发人员理解代码的执行流程。
- 调试错误信息:当代码出现错误时,开发者工具会显示错误信息,并定位到错误发生的位置。通过查看错误信息和相关的调用栈信息,可以帮助开发人员快速定位和修复错误。
在Angular 4/CLI的TypeScript中调试的优势包括:
- 快速定位问题:通过设置断点和查看变量值、调用栈等信息,可以快速定位代码中的问题,提高调试效率。
- 提高代码质量:调试可以帮助开发人员发现并修复代码中的错误,提高代码的质量和稳定性。
- 加深对代码的理解:通过逐步执行代码和查看变量值,可以更深入地理解代码的执行流程和逻辑。
在Angular 4/CLI的TypeScript中调试的应用场景包括:
- 定位和修复代码错误:当代码出现错误时,可以使用调试工具定位错误的位置,并进行修复。
- 调试复杂逻辑:当代码逻辑较为复杂时,可以使用调试工具逐步执行代码,帮助理解和验证代码的执行流程。
- 优化性能问题:通过调试工具可以查看代码的执行时间和资源消耗情况,帮助开发人员找出性能瓶颈并进行优化。
腾讯云提供了一系列与云计算相关的产品,可以帮助开发人员进行云计算的开发和部署。具体推荐的产品和产品介绍链接地址如下:
- 云服务器(CVM):提供可扩展的云服务器实例,支持多种操作系统和应用场景。产品介绍链接
- 云数据库MySQL版(CDB):提供稳定可靠的云数据库服务,支持高可用、备份恢复、性能优化等功能。产品介绍链接
- 云存储(COS):提供安全可靠的云存储服务,支持海量数据存储和访问。产品介绍链接
- 人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。产品介绍链接
- 物联网(IoT):提供全面的物联网解决方案,包括设备接入、数据管理、应用开发等。产品介绍链接
请注意,以上推荐的产品和链接仅为示例,实际使用时需要根据具体需求进行选择。